Surface Modification and Heat Generation of FePt Nanoparticles
The chemical reduction of ferric acetylacetonate (Fe(acac)(3)) and platinum acetylacetonate (Pt(acac)(2)) using the polyol solvent of phenyl ether as an agent as well as an effective surfactant has successfully yielded monodispersive FePt nanoparticles (NPs) with a hydrophobic ligand and a size of a...
